Just when you thought your photography and videography couldn't get any better, the Rokinon 12mm T2.2 Cine Lens for Micro Four Thirds Mount steps in to elevate your craft. This high-quality, durable lens is specifically optimized for digital cinematography, making it a reliable choice for both professionals and amateurs alike.
Designed to produce an image circle that perfectly covers APS-C sized sensors or smaller, this lens ensures you capture every detail in your frame. It features a wide-angle view, making it an excellent choice for shooting expansive landscapes, intricate architecture, or capturing the essence of tight interior locations.
The lens boasts a fast maximum aperture of T2.2, making it a versatile tool for low-light shooting. This feature allows you to create stunning, sharp images even in challenging lighting conditions.
For those who use a follow focus unit, this lens comes with focus and aperture rings that feature industry-standard 0.8 pitch gearing. The aperture ring is de-clicked, allowing for smooth iris pulls while shooting, enhancing the quality of your footage.
To aid focus pullers, the lens has focus, aperture, and depth of field markings on the side. This thoughtful design feature ensures that operators on the side of the camera can easily access the necessary information.
The Rokinon 12mm T2.2 Cine Lens also incorporates three extra-low dispersion elements and two aspherical elements into its optical design. This advanced technology minimizes chromatic aberrations and distortion, resulting in sharper, more vibrant images.
To further enhance image quality, a Nano Coating System (NCS) has been applied to the lens elements. This innovative system reduces surface reflections and prevents lens flare and ghosting, improving light transmission and creating more contrast-rich imagery.
The lens comes with a bayonet-mount lens hood and a lens pouch for added convenience and protection. With its affordable price and superior features, the Rokinon 12mm T2.2 Cine Lens for Micro Four Thirds Mount is a valuable addition to any photography or videography kit.
